CAT 2024 Slot 2 Analysis: Moderate Difficulty, Easier VARC, and Challenging DILR

The CAT 2024 Slot 2 exam, conducted from 12:30 PM to 2:30 PM on November 24, presented aspirants with a mix of easier and more challenging sections. While the Verbal Ability and Reading Comprehension (VARC) section was relatively straightforward, the Data Interpretation and Logical Reasoning (DILR) section proved tricky. Overall, the exam was rated moderate in difficulty, with good attempts estimated at 44+ questions.

CAT 2024 Slot 2 Highlights

  • Date and Time: November 24, 2024 | 12:30 PM – 2:30 PM
  • Exam Pattern: Total 68 questions—VARC (24), DILR (22), and QA (22).
  • Good Attempts: 18-20 in VARC, 12+ in DILR, and 12+ in QA.
  • Difficulty Level: Moderate.
  • Participants: Approximately 85,000 students in Slot 2.

Section-wise Difficulty Analysis for Slot 2

Verbal Ability and Reading Comprehension (VARC)

The VARC section in Slot 2 was the easiest among the three sections, featuring 24 questions with two TITA questions. Reading Comprehension (RC) passages were manageable, and Para Jumbles made an appearance, unlike Slot 1.

  • Good Attempts: 18-20.
  • Difficulty Level: Easy to Moderate.

Data Interpretation and Logical Reasoning (DILR)

The DILR section posed significant challenges for aspirants. It included 22 questions, with eight TITA questions, distributed across five sets (three sets of four questions and two sets of five questions).

  • Good Attempts: 12+.
  • Difficulty Level: Moderate to Difficult.

Quantitative Aptitude (QA)

The QA section was formula-driven and covered familiar topics like Simple Interest and Compound Interest (SICI) and Time and Work. Of the 22 questions, six were TITA.

  • Good Attempts: 12+.
  • Difficulty Level: Moderate.

Slot 1 vs Slot 2 Comparison

While Slot 1 was deemed slightly easier overall, Slot 2 had a tougher DILR section but an easier VARC. According to Bhushan Bapat, Head of Academics (CAT Division) at Supergrads, Slot 1’s moderate difficulty and manageable sections suggest higher cutoffs this year.

CAT 2024 Exam Overview

The Indian Institute of Management Calcutta conducted CAT 2024 across 170 cities in three slots, with 3.29 lakh active registrations. The pattern remained consistent, featuring a total of 68 questions divided across three sections.

Key Dates to Remember

  • Answer Key Release: The official CAT 2024 answer key will be available on the IIM CAT website (iimcat.ac.in) within 3–4 days of the exam.
  • Result Declaration: Results are expected in January 2025.
